9 Troubleshooting

9.1.2 Troubleshooting of Alarms

9-22

A.Eb1:
Safety Function Signal

Input Timing Error

The lag between activations of

the input signals /HWBB1 and

/HWBB2 for the HWBB function

is ten second or more.

Measure the time lag between the /

HWBB1 and

/HWBB2 signals.

The output signal circuits or devices

for /HWBB1 and

/HWBB2 or the SERVOPACK

input signal circuits may be faulty.

Alternatively, the input signal

cables may be disconnected. Check

if any of these items are faulty or

have been disconnected.

A.Ed1:
Command Execution

Timeout

A timeout error occurred when
using an MECHATROLINK
command.

Check the motor status when the

command is executed.

Execute the SV_ON or SENS_ON
command only when the motor is
not running.

For fully-closed loop control, check
the status of the external encoder

after an output is made to execute
the command.

Execute the SENS_ON command
only when an external encoder is
connected.

A.F10:
Main Circuit Cable

Open Phase
(With the main power

supply ON, voltage was

low for more than 1 sec-

ond in an R, S, or T

phase.)
(Detected when the main

power supply was turned

ON.)

The three-phase power supply

wiring is incorrect.

Check the power supply wiring.

Confirm that the power supply is

correctly wired.

The three-phase power supply is

unbalanced.

Measure the voltage at each phase

of the three-phase power supply.

Balance the power supply by chang-

ing phases.

A single-phase power is input

without setting Pn00B.2 (power

supply method for three-phase

SERVOPACK) to 1 (single-phase

power supply).

Check the power supply and the

parameter setting.

Match the parameter setting to the

power supply.

A SERVOPACK fault occurred.

Turn the power supply OFF and

then ON again. If the alarm still

occurs, the SERVOPACK may be

faulty. Replace the SERVOPACK.

A.F50:
Servomotor Main

Circuit Cable

Disconnection
(The servomotor did not

operate or power was not

supplied to the servomo-

tor even though the

SV_ON (Servo ON)

command was input

when the servomotor

was ready to receive it.)

A SERVOPACK fault occurred.

The SERVOPACK may be faulty.

Replace the SERVOPACK.

The wiring is not correct or there

is a faulty contact in the motor

wiring.

Check the wiring.

Make sure that the servomotor is

correctly wired.

CPF00:
Digital Operator

Transmission Error 1

The contact between the digital
operator and the SERVOPACK is
faulty.

Check the connector contact.

Insert securely the connector or
replace the cable.

Malfunction caused by noise
interference.

Keep the digital operator or the

cable away from noise sources.

CPF01:
Digital Operator
Transmission Error 2

A digital operator fault occurred.

Disconnect the digital operator and
then re-connect it. If the alarm still
occurs, the digital operator may be
faulty. Replace the digital operator.

A SERVOPACK fault occurred.

Turn the power supply OFF and
then ON again. If the alarm still
occurs, the SERVOPACK may be
faulty. Replace the SERVOPACK.

∗2. These alarms are not stored in the alarm history and are displayed only in the panel display.
